COWI names new CFO

Claire Cobden joins international consulting group.

COWI has announced the addition of Claire Cobden to the company. She joins the firm as chief financial officer for North America.

Bringing several years of senior leadership experience across multiple industries to the role, she has held key positions in the fields of information systems engineering, financial services and gaming.

A chartered professional accountant, Cobden holds the chartered financial analyst designation. She sits on the board of CFA Society Vancouver, most recently serving as treasurer. In 2019, she was named British Columbia’s Most Influential Women in Finance.

COWI is a leading international consulting group within engineering, economics and environmental science. With offices across the world, COWI provides clients with innovative and sustainable solutions to complex challenges within infrastructure, buildings, environment, water, energy, industry and planning. In North America, COWI is a premier provider of planning, design and program management services within the transportation and energy sectors.
